Specifications:
Frame: SuperX Carbon, Proportional Response construction, internal cable routing, 12x142mm thru-axle, UDH, BSA 68mm threaded BB, flat mount disc, integrated seatpost binder
Fork: SuperX Carbon, integrated crown race, 12x100mm thru-axle, flat mount disc, internal routing, 1-1/8" to 1-1/2" Delta steerer, 55mm offset
Headsets: Integrated, 1-1/8" - 1.5"
Handlebar: Vision Trimax Aero Alloy: 400mm (46-51cm), 420mm (54-61cm)
Stem: Cannondale C1 Conceal, Alloy, 31.8, -6°: 90mm (46-51m), 100mm (54-56cm), 110mm (58-61cm)
Bar Tape: Cannondale Bar Tape, 3.5mm
Crank: SRAM Apex 1 Wide, 40T: 165mm (46cm), 170mm (51cm), 172.5 (54-56cm), 175mm (58-61cm)
Bottom Bracket: SRAM DUB BSA Road 68 Wide
Cassette: SRAM Apex XPLR PG-1231, 11-44, 12-speed
Chain: SRAM Apex, 12-speed
Shifters: SRAM Apex AXS, 12-speed
Rear Derailleur: SRAM Apex AXS XPLR, 12-speed
Brakes: SRAM Apex hydraulic disc, Centerline 160/160mm centerlock rotors
Rims: DT Swiss G540, 24mm inner width, 28h, tubeless ready
Hubs: (F) DT Swiss 370, 12x100mm centerlock / (R) DT Swiss 370 LN Ratchet System, 12x142mm centerlock
Spokes: DT Swiss Champion
Tires: Vittoria Terreno T50, 700x40c, tubeless ready
Saddle: Fizik Vento Argo X5, S-Alloy rails, 140mm
Seatpost: Cannondale C1 Aero 27 Carbon, SmartSense compatible, 0mm offset (46cm), 15mm offset (51-61cm)
